Lynn Edward “Butch” Ceason was born October 4, 1941, in La Crosse, Wisconsin, to Fred and Margaret (Culbert) Ceason. He died at his home on February 5, 2026.

Lynn and the love of his life, Ellen Hegenbart,h celebrated 62 years of marriage in June 2025. They built a loving family, including 4 daughters: Sandi, Kelli, Kristi, and Jodi. They managed to raise their four girls in a one-bathroom house! Their family eventually expanded to include their two beloved grandchildren. Lynn retired from UW-La Crosse after 40 years. He continued to meet up with several of his co-workers/friends for golfing and breakfasts.

Lynn and his family spent many vacations camping and were big card players. Until the pandemic, Lynn and Ellen spent their winters in Arizona. Lynn loved to golf and to do woodworking in his shed. He made beautiful Christmas ornaments, bowls, pens, and other items for his family and friends. He loved to pet his dog, Walter, and all of his grand-dogs.

Lynn is survived by his beloved wife, Ellen; his children, Sandi Weber, Kelli Redfearn, Kristi Ceason, and Jodi Ceason; his son-in-law, John Theisen, and daughter’s partner, Dave Scott; grandchildren Maggi Weber and Zachary Redfearn (Sky Smiley), his brother Mike Ceason, sisters-in-law Julie Ceason and Hansie Hegenbarth; many nieces and nephews and his dog Walter.

He was preceded in death by his brothers-in-law Babe Mooney, Norb Hegenbarth, Greg Hegenbarth, and Chet Miller; sisters-in-law Marian Mooney, Clarie Miller, Nita Bluske, Marnie Hegenbarth and Sue Hegenbarth; and son-in-law Fred Weber.

Visitation is scheduled for Thursday, February 12, from 5:00 PM to 7:00 PM at Schumacher-Kish Funeral and Cremation Services of La Crosse. A private family burial will take place at Oak Grove Cemetery at a later time.
